Abstract

An investigation of the impact of logging operations on crown damage by using the aerial photograph  of forest  areas of PT. INHUTANI II in Pulau Laut, South Kalimantan was carried out.The results of the investigation lead to the following conclusions:1.  Panchromatic   black and white  aerial photograph of 1:20.000 scale is good  enough  to  use for  evaluating  the damage of dominant and codominant crowns and crown  closure of the trees. It is found that  the crown of  11 trees/ha  were damaged, consisted of 9 tree crowns were damaged partially and  2  tree crowns  were damaged  totally.2.   Steeper terrains  caused  larger decrease  of  crown closure  of  the  trees. On  the slope  of  0-15%,  25-45% and 45%  and above, the  crown  closure  reductions   were  61%, 76%  and 80%,  respectively
